RS-232C input / output
Pin No. Name
1 NC
2 RXD
3 TXD
4 NC
5 GND
6 NC
7 NC
8 NC
9 NC
This monitor uses RXD, TXD and GND lines for RS-232C control.

The monitor is equipped with a LAN port (RJ-45). Connecting the monitor to a network allows you to receive email notications
from the monitor and control the monitor from a computer via a network. To use a LAN connection, you are required to assign an
IP address to the monitor (page 77).
The monitor will obtain an IP address automatically when connected to a DHCP network.
 Set [Control Interface] under [Control Settings] to [LAN] (page 77).
